Lyon forward Mariano Diaz has turned down a return to Real Madrid this summer, with fellow Spanish side Sevilla reportedly eyeing up a move for the attacker.

This is according to Don Balon, who note that Los Blancos had contacted the player’s agent about a move this summer, and that they were willing to double the wage Mariano is on at Lyon.

The report also states that Sevilla have made an approach for the 25-year-old, so it looks like Real aren’t alone in their pursuit of the striker this summer.

Mariano has turned down a last-minute switch to Real Madrid this summer

Mariano, who Don Balon have stated in the past has an asking price of €80M, would be a superb signing for Real, however it most likely would be one that angers some fans considering they club only let the player leave last summer.

Mariano proved to be absolutely lethal for Lyon this season just gone, as he bagged 21 goals and seven assists in all competitions to help the club secure a third place finish in the league.

With Karim Benzema seriously struggling to find his form these past few years, Mariano would’ve been a smart signing by Los Blancos, however following this recent report, it doesn’t seem as if a move will be materialising this summer.

Only time will tell if Real bring in a forward to compete with Benzema this summer, however if they are to, they only have a few days to get a deal over the line considering the transfer window closes next week.
